E Skip strong in Fresno

Oddly I was getting a station from Lubbock TX in Fresno around 6:30 tonight. 97.3 Yes! FM. I have received 95.5 KLOS from L.A. a couple times in the past as well as Sacramento, San Francisco and Chico stations but this is by far the furthest I've ever picked up.
 
Yea, it's that time of year. My TV extremes are between Bakersfield KBFX/KBAK & KNVN Chico tonight.
Not as interesting as watching analog TV skip in the past, but that's progress. Just can't see anything out of state now. Canada & Texas would blow into the valley in the NTSC world. 8)

There was lots of e-skip on the West Coast on the evening of July24. That followed a VERY significant skip event for much of the east coast, with skip as far up the dial as 200 mHz in some places.
It wasn't _that_ unusual in the west, but from Seattle I had Arizona and Nebraska in at the same time. For me the skip lasted about 90 minutes, beginning at 7 PM.
As in Fresno, a friend in the San Francisco bay area was receiving west Texas FM.

That's not e-skip. It's a different form of propagation called "tropo" which is short for "tropospheric ducting."
It's fun, and most likely to happen when there's a huge area of high pressure (most likely in the Central Valley when the winter fog has been in place over a 300-mile radius for several days.
Trop usually covers a shorter distance than e-skip.
In this case, Fresno to Sacto is a couple hundred miles, (trop), as compared with Fresno to Lubbock, Texas on June 24 e-skip.)
No matter what it's called, it's fun to hear stations we don't usually get.
